Random Variable
A variable characterized by numerical outcomes derived from phenomena of chance.
Population Mean
The average value of a given characteristic across the entire population.
Probability Distribution
A mathematical description of a random phenomenon in terms of the probabilities of various possible outcomes.
Sample Size
The number of observations or data points collected in a sample from a population.
